在使用removeChild方法時,可以采取一些措施來保持DOM結構的穩定:
在刪除子節點之前,可以先使用cloneNode方法創建一個子節點的副本,然后再刪除原始子節點。這樣可以保留原始子節點的結構和屬性,避免對原始子節點的操作影響到其他部分的代碼。
在刪除子節點之前,可以先判斷該子節點是否存在,避免在不存在的情況下調用removeChild方法造成錯誤。
在刪除子節點之前,可以先將該子節點保存到一個變量中,以備將來可能需要重新插入到DOM中。
在刪除子節點之后,可以手動更新DOM結構,確保刪除操作不會對其他部分的代碼產生影響。
通過以上方法,可以有效地保持DOM結構的穩定性,避免出現意外的情況。